Hangzhou is a city you can visit over and over again and never get tired of! Here is a 3-day itinerary to help you explore the unique charm of this famous city in the Jiangnan region. 📍Hangzhou, the capital of Zhejiang Province, has a history of over 2,000 years. The city is a perfect blend of natural beauty and urban prosperity. West Lake is like a bright pearl set in the city, and the Lingyin Temple is a place of tranquility and meditation. The Qiantang River is a magnificent sight, and the streets and alleys are filled with the charm of Jiangnan. Every corner of the city is captivating. 🚌Transportation ✈️Plane: After arriving at Hangzhou Xiaoshan International Airport, you can take the airport bus to various locations in the city or transfer to the subway, which is convenient and fast. 🚄High-speed train: Hangzhou East Railway Station and Hangzhou Railway Station have many trains, and there are clear signs in the station to help you transfer to the subway, bus, or other transportation to the attractions and hotels. 🚌City transportation: Buses and subways cover almost all attractions, and you can also ride a shared bike along the paths by West Lake, feel the breeze, and enjoy the scenery along the way. 🗺Itinerary Day 1: West Lake Broken Bridge - Bai Causeway - Solitary Hill - Yue Fei Temple - Su Causeway - Viewing Fish at Flower Harbor - Leifeng Pagoda - Hubin Yintai Stroll along West Lake, starting from the Broken Bridge in the morning, enjoy the beautiful scenery along the way, and visit Yue Fei Temple to learn about history. In the afternoon, walk along Su Causeway to Viewing Fish at Flower Harbor to see the red fish playing, and climb Leifeng Pagoda at dusk to overlook the panoramic view of West Lake. Have dinner and go shopping at Hubin Yintai in the evening. Day 2: Lingyin Temple - Yongfu Temple - Faxi Temple - Xixi Wetland Visit Lingyin Temple in the morning to feel the tranquility, listen to the bells of the ancient temple, and pray for your family. Yongfu Temple is next to Lingyin Temple, and its unique architectural style is worth a visit. Then go to Faxi Temple, a popular spot for taking beautiful photos. In the afternoon, go to Xixi Wetland, take a boat ride through the waterways, and enjoy the beautiful scenery of the wetland. Day 3: Nine Creeks and Eighteen Gullies - Longjing Village - Qiantang River Bridge Take a walk in Nine Creeks and Eighteen Gullies in the morning, breathe fresh air, and explore the mountain streams. Have authentic Longjing tea and farmhouse dishes in Longjing Village at noon. Go to Qiantang River Bridge in the afternoon to admire the majestic bridge and river view and feel the blend of history and modernity. 🌟Must-visit attractions 1. West Lake: The scenery varies in different seasons, and the lake is beautiful in sunny, rainy, and snowy weather. Stroll along the lake, with willows swaying and the lake shimmering, as if you are in a painting. 2. Lingyin Temple: A thousand-year-old temple with a strong incense atmosphere, the temple buildings are simple and elegant, and the environment is tranquil and peaceful. Every brick and tile tells the story of time. 3. Leifeng Pagoda: Although newly built, it is unique. Standing on the top of the pagoda, you can enjoy the beautiful scenery of West Lake, especially at sunset when the afterglow shines on the pagoda, which is spectacular. 4. Xixi Wetland: A natural wetland in the city, with abundant water and vegetation. Take a boat tour and feel like you are in a paradise. 5. Faxi Temple: With yellow walls and black tiles, it is full of Zen. The popular spots in the temple attract many tourists to take photos, and it is said to be very effective for praying for love. 6. Nine Creeks and Eighteen Gullies: The mountain streams flow gently, the trees are lush, and the mist is like a fairyland, making it a great place for hiking and sightseeing. 7. Qiantang River Bridge: The first double-deck railway and highway bridge designed and built by China, it is majestic and witnesses the vicissitudes of history. 💕Travel experience During my three days in Hangzhou, I was completely immersed in the gentle charm of Jiangnan. Everything here makes me feel comfortable and relaxed, and it is a place I don't want to leave. 🍜Food recommendations 1. Vinegar fish: The fish is tender, and the sweet and sour sauce is rich and mellow, melting in your mouth. It is a classic representative of Hangzhou cuisine. 2. Longjing shrimp: Fresh shrimp with fragrant Longjing tea, the shrimp is chewy, and the tea aroma is overflowing, with a fresh and elegant taste. 3. Congbaohui: A Hangzhou specialty snack, with a crispy outer layer and a chewy filling of green onions and fried dough sticks, served with sweet sauce, salty and delicious. 4. Dingsheng cake: Soft and glutinous, sweet but not greasy, with a light rice fragrance and delicate and sweet red bean paste filling, it is a snack full of Jiangnan flavor. 🏨Hotel accommodation 1. The rooms are spacious and comfortable. 💡Tips 1. West Lake is large, and you can take a sightseeing bus or boat if you want to save energy. 2. Pay attention to dress appropriately and avoid loud noises when visiting temples such as Lingyin Temple. 3. The weather in Hangzhou is changeable, so remember to bring rain gear and sunscreen. 4. When tasting famous dishes such as West Lake vinegar fish, you can choose some well-known old restaurants for a more guaranteed taste.
